Sidewalk leveling services involve the process of restoring uneven or sunken concrete walkways to a safer and more level condition. This typically includes techniques such as mudjacking or slabjacking, where a specialized mixture is injected beneath the existing concrete to lift and stabilize it. The goal is to eliminate trip hazards and improve the overall appearance of the sidewalk, making it safer for pedestrians and more appealing for property owners.
These services address common problems caused by soil erosion, ground shifting, or freeze-thaw cycles that can lead to cracked or uneven sidewalks. Over time, these issues can create unsafe walking conditions and potentially lead to further structural damage if left unaddressed. By leveling the surface, property owners can prevent accidents and reduce the likelihood of costly repairs or replacements in the future.

Per Square Foot Cost - Sidewalk leveling services typically range from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ness. For a standard 4-foot wide sidewalk, prices might be between $120 and $320 for a 10-foot section.
Per Linear Foot Cost - Many contractors charge between $10 and $20 per linear foot for sidewalk leveling. This rate varies based on the severity of the unevenness and the complexity of the work involved.
Full Section Replacement - Complete sidewalk replacement can cost from $4,000 to $8,000 for an average residential walkway, with prices influenced by material choices and site conditions.
Additional Fees - Costs for permits, debris removal, or site prep may add $200 to $1,000 to the overall project, depending on local regulations and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is sidewalk leveling? Sidewalk leveling involves adjusting and restoring uneven or sunken concrete slabs to create a smooth, level surface. Local service providers typically perform this work to improve safety and appearance.
Why should I consider sidewalk leveling? Leveling can help prevent tripping hazards, improve accessibility, and enhance curb appeal by correcting uneven surfaces caused by ground shifting or settling.
How do professionals perform sidewalk leveling? Contractors often use tech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ection to lift and stabilize the concrete slabs efficiently.
Is sidewalk leveling a permanent solution? While effective, the longevity of sidewalk leveling depends on soil conditions and proper installation. Consulting local pros can provide guidance tailored to specific needs.
